Where is fall foliage in PA?

In southeastern Pennsylvania, places like Wissahickon Valley in Philadelphia's Fairmount Park, as well as Valley Forge National Historical Park, offer excellent viewing opportunities. Here are some great spots for fall foliage elsewhere across the Keystone State: Pine Creek Gorge (the "Grand Canyon of Pennsylvania")

Does Pennsylvania have mountains?

Pennsylvania Geography The Appalachian Mountains slice through the center of Pennsylvania, with the Allegheny and Pocano Mountains, the state's most significant subranges. The highest point in the state is Mt. Davis, at 3,213 ft. Pennsylvania is home to more deep and useful rivers than any other U.S. State.

What are fall colors?

Autumn leaf color is a phenomenon that affects the normal green leaves of many deciduous trees and shrubs by which they take on, during a few weeks in the autumn season, various shades of yellow, orange, red, purple, and brown.

Are the leaves changing in the Smokies yet?

The leaves typically start to change around early to mid October. The highest elevations of the Smoky Mountains will likely have their most vibrant fall colors around the end of October, and leaves in the surrounding area are expected to peak about a week later.
